Forum: EasyBoot Topic: boot in vm -> ok | boot real -> file not found started by: Vista_24 Posted by Vista_24 on Sep. 15 2010,15:25
Hello,i have create a multiboot cd and i have test it in Vmware and Virtual PC .. all works very fine. Now i have burn the image to a disk ... boot with the disk and see the menu ... now i want start any application ... and now comes the error message "file not found" or he jumps back to menu ... why? where is the problem? @Vista_24Strange behaviour that all applications fail Still need more information, as this can be a hard nut to crack ![]() ![]() When you create ISO in EasyBoot – what settings do you check in “Option” (“Joliet”, “Allow lower case” etcetera)? What command do you use to launch applications? Test this: It’s a long shoot, but use UltraIso to create a new ISO with files and folders from inside of folder disk1 and use file “loader.bin” in folder ezboot as boot-file in UltraIso balder Posted by Vista_24 on Sep. 15 2010,16:10
QUOTE When you create ISO in EasyBoot – what settings do you check in “Option” (“Joliet”, “Allow lower case” etcetera)? ![]() QUOTE What command do you use to launch applications? run seatools.ima bcdw /ezboot/isolinux.bin memdisk initrd=difs16c.img run windiag.img bootinfotable;run toolstar.bif run ntpw.img bootinfotable;run acronis.bif QUOTE It’s a long shoot, but use UltraIso to create a new ISO with files and folders from inside of folder disk1 and use file “loader.bin” in folder ezboot as boot-file in UltraIso Ok, thanks .. i test it now best regards Posted by Vista_24 on Sep. 18 2010,15:28
Hello,i think i have found the Problem :-P The function "Allow lower case" was not enabled ... now the boot CD works ... but I still have some problems ... i will test any more. Thanks best regards |
